Birth Injuries Causes and Treatment

The most frequent causes of birth injuries are due to medical malpractice, including the negligence of obstetricians. These kinds of errors can be experienced during labor and birth, as well as after the child is born. The most serious injuries are cerebral palsy brachial plexus injuries, and hypoxic-ischemic encephalopathy (HIE). They can also cause infections, fractured bones, and physical harm to infants and children.
Babies don't have the ability to communicate what they are feeling It is the responsibility of parents and healthcare professionals to be on the lookout for any signs of potential issues. These could include unusual behavior such as fevers, crying incessantly or a lack of. It can also include seizures or skull fractures, loss of movement, paralysis, and loss of muscle control. Some symptoms are obvious immediately, while others may take weeks or years to manifest themselves.
Some birth injuries can be treated with medications or physical therapy, while others require surgery. For instance the removal of a hematoma or skull fracture is usually required in order to heal the condition. Babies with cerebral palsy may require assistive devices to move around, for instance wheelchairs or leg braces. Other conditions could require blood transfusions, oxygen therapy or Burr Hole Surgery for a Hemangioma.

A successful birth injury lawsuit will have to establish a variety of legal aspects. It is essential to prove that the defendant was legally bound to act in accordance with the standard of care and expertise that other medical professionals apply in similar circumstances. This is referred to as the standard of care and is typically established by expert testimony.
AccidentInjuryLawyers must also show that the defendant's actions did not meet the requirements of this standard by proving that their actions, or lack of it, caused your child's injury at birth. You will need expert medical witnesses to prove that the defendant’s negligence caused your child’s birth injury.
In addition to nurses and doctors, the defendants in the birth injury lawsuit may include medical or hospital facilities where the injury occurred, pharmaceutical companies that manufacture drugs utilized during the pregnancy or delivery as well as manufacturers of medical equipment used during childbirth. An experienced attorney will investigate the details of your case to determine the potential defendants.
If you're pursuing a claim based on birth injury, it is important to act fast. The statute of limitations sets strict deadlines within which you can file your lawsuit, and failing to do so could cause you to lose your right to recover damages.
